Bzip2アルゴリズムハードウェアアクセラレーション方式

Bzip2アルゴリズムハードウェアアクセラレーション方式
本発明は、Bzip2 アルゴリズムのハードウェア アクセラレーション実装方法を開示する。この方法は、ハードウェア アクセラレータを利用して、プログラム内で実行時間が長くなる事前変換とランレングス エンコーディングを実装し、プログラムの圧縮速度を加速します。以下の機能があります:

まず、ハードウェアアクセラレータの入力バッファと出力バッファを一般的なコンピューティングシステムとの通信インターフェイスとして使用し、ソフトウェアを使用してハードウェアアクセラレータの入力データを準備し、出力データを整理して読み取ることで、ハードウェアアクセラレータの設計を簡素化します。
第二に、事前変換とランレングス符号化はハードウェアで実装され、完全に拡張された 2048 ビットの並列コンパレータとシフタを使用してプログラムの実行を高速化し、Bzip2 アルゴリズムのデータ圧縮速度を高速化し、プログラムのパフォーマンスを効果的に向上させます。

申請日: 2009年1月22日
発行日: 2009年7月8日
認可発表日:
出願人/特許権者:浙江大学
申請者住所:浙江省杭州市西湖区浙大路38号
発明者および設計者:陳天州、ヤン・ライク、胡偉、王剛、馮徳貴、呉斌斌、陳度、王永剛、劉静偉
特許庁:杭州秋実特許代理有限公司
エージェント:リン・ホアイユ
特許の種類:発明特許
カテゴリー番号: H03M7/30;G06F9/38
Bzip2 アルゴリズムの特許に関連する主要図\公開仕様\認可仕様を表示するには、ここをクリックしてください。

【編集者のおすすめ】

  1. プログラムデバッグのための Linux Bash コマンドの詳細な説明
  2. Linux Bash コマンドのショートカット キー アプリケーションについて
  3. Linux Bash Shellシステムの詳細な応用
  4. Linux Bash固有のインストール手順と使用方法の紹介
  5. Linux Bashコマンドクエリ関連イベントの詳細な説明

<<:  LEACHプロトコルのアルゴリズムと特徴

>>:  eMule プロトコルの DHT アルゴリズム

ブログ    
ブログ    
ブログ    

推薦する

...

...

機械学習モデルの導入における課題に対処する方法

[[377893]] [51CTO.com クイック翻訳] データとオープンソースの機械学習フレーム...

インテリジェントロボット:伝染病との戦いを強化し、スマート医療への道を探る

ビッグデータ技術は画像認識や遺伝子配列解析などの分野で先駆的な役割を果たしており、インテリジェントロ...

機械学習とディープラーニングの違いを簡単に分析する

【51CTO.com クイック翻訳】 [[379353]]現代社会に人工知能の波が押し寄せる中、機械...

...

これは機械学習ツールに関する最も包括的なハンドブックかもしれません。

[[419906]]私はこれまで、人工知能とデータサイエンスのオープンソース プロジェクトを数多く...

DeepSpeechを使用してアプリ内で音声をテキストに変換する

アプリでの音声認識は単なる楽しい機能ではなく、重要なアクセシビリティ機能です。コンピュータの主な機能...

鵬城クラウドブレインは鵬城シリーズの大型モデルの基礎研究をサポート

[[401368]]専門家の皆さん、ゲストの皆さん、こんにちは。今日は主に、Pengcheng Bi...

...

2021年以降の人工知能トレンドに関する5つの予測

アンドリュー・ン教授(スタンフォード大学コンピュータサイエンスおよび電気工学准教授)は、「人工知能は...

2021 年のイノベーションを形作る 5 つのテクノロジー トレンド

近い将来、世界はテクノロジーとイノベーションのブームを迎えるでしょう。私たちは世界中で大規模なデジタ...

LRUアルゴリズムの概念から実装まで、React非同期開発の未来

[[428240]]みなさんこんにちは、カソンです。 React ソース コードは、さまざまなモジュ...

人工知能とクラウドコンピューティングはアプリケーションエコシステムの形成を加速させている

[[430244]]現在、人工知能は生産性の向上を可能にし、さまざまな産業のインテリジェント化と新旧...